Output 3d4d35627251fb21fcb8aedb51d451d8691b953f2bd6e27cfc1a2c4794c99abd:3

value
624841
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d892777ed5f846419b44d7e17e8516ee265eef OP_EQUALVERIFY OP_CHECKSIG
address
181KoGwpDNNEVvWyEvHpM2SLWQDXwLvofS
transaction
3d4d35627251fb21fcb8aedb51d451d8691b953f2bd6e27cfc1a2c4794c99abd
confirmations
677675
spent
true